【数据结构】— 稀疏数组

【数据结构】— 稀疏数组

概念:什么是稀疏数组. 当一个数组a中大部分元素为0,或者为同一个值,那么可以用稀疏数组b来保存数组a。. 首先,稀疏数组是一个数组,然后以一种特定的方式来保存上述的数组a,具体处理方法:. 记录数组a一共有几行几列. 记录a中有多少个不同的值. 最后记录不同值的元素所在行列,以及具体...

数据结构之稀疏数组

数据结构之稀疏数组

数据结构之稀疏数组概念当一个数组中大部分元素为0,或者为同一值的数组时,可以使用稀疏数组来保存该数组。稀疏数组的处理方式是:记录数组一共有几行几列,有多少个不同值;把具有不同值的元素和行列及值记录在一个小规模的数组中,从而缩小程序的规模如下图:左边是原始数组,右边是稀疏数组解析代码package c...

Go语言核心编程 - 数据结构和算法

47 课时 |
1657 人已学 |
免费
开发者课程背景图

本页面内关键词为智能算法引擎基于机器学习所生成,如有任何问题,可在页面下方点击"联系我们"与我们沟通。

社区圈子

算法编程
算法编程
开发者社区在线编程频道官方技术圈。包含算法资源更新,周赛动态,每日一题互动。
508+人已加入
加入
相关电子书
更多
如何使用Tair增强数据结构构建丰富在线实时场景
Apache Flink 流式应用中状态的数据结构定义升级
立即下载 立即下载